When we think of the things that we value most, family is usually a top priority. Still we are seeing a breakdown of family and family values across this country. One of the problems is that people simply do not know how to enhance their family relationships. They also struggle with the need to find some way to balance work and family. Get It Together Before It's Too Late offers practical suggestions that will help resolve those family problems. It is based on a study of marriage at Washington University in St. Louis. Bill Little has lead seminars on balancing work and family for more than thirty years for some of the leading companies in the United States. Strengthen your family by reading and applying this knowledge to your own life. It will enrich your work and family relationships and greatly improve your communication skills.

Nick Jelaco returns home after successfully litigating the most important case of his career and walks into a nightmare. His wife has been brutally murdered, and his young daughter is missing. As Nick searches for answers, he finds an unlikely friend in Simone Panache, the sister of convicted murderer Cole Panache. As the improbable allies work together to unravel a web of lies and corruption dating back to Cole's murder conviction, the partners uncover a conspiracy involving police officers, lawyers from Nick's law firm, and the prosecutor who put Simone's brother in prison. In Christopher Meyerhoeffer's gripping novel, Dismissed with Prejudice, one father risks everything as he seeks to save his daughter from a delusional killer. Suspicious of those who should be his closest allies, Nick turns to his Special Forces training and knowledge of the law in an attempt to find his daughter. However, getting his little girl back proves to be more difficult and dangerous than he ever imagined. Powerful people have secrets, and they will do whatever it takes to keep them buried, including murder...
